Key Responsibilities- Perform preventive and predictive maintenance as well as complex repairs on a variety of mechanical equipment relative to the assigned location.
- Apply intermediate diagnostic and troubleshooting knowledge to resolve equipment issues effectively.
- Conduct advanced function testing to verify equipment readiness and operational safety following maintenance activities.
- Read, interpret, and work from detailed mechanical schematics, drawings, and blueprints.
- Identify parts and execute system searches to ensure accurate procurement of necessary spare parts.
- Ensure adherence, accurate input, and ongoing maintenance of data within Halliburton's system of record.
- Follow specific and detailed work processes outlined in the Halliburton Management System (HMS) during daily operations.
- Perform assigned tasks independently while mentoring junior team members as directed.
- Maintain a strict commitment to safety, efficiency, and cost containment in all daily duties.
- A high school diploma or equivalent qualification.
- A minimum of 3 years of hands-on experience in related mechanical fields.
- A Technical School certificate is strongly preferred.
- Proficiency in mechanical interpretation, system diagnostics, and safety compliance.
